How old was your yorkie when they left bows in their hair? Okay, so how old were you guys' yorkies when they started wearing bows in their hair without taking them out the second you put them in? I've been pulling Heidi's hair up since it was long enough (she's only a little over 4 months old). She will leave in a rubberband until it works its way out from her playing, but when I put a bow in, she takes it out as soon as I let go of her. Will she eventually leave a bow in? |
lexi is 2 now and keeps them in... if they come out, she runs to me to fix it cause her hair is all in her eyes and she cant see. |
I would start out by putting a little flat clip in her hair. Let her get used to the weight of that and then gradually get a barrette that clips, and then go to the bows. |
